What is a 2000 Mercury Cougar Wiring Diagram and Why It Matters
A 2000 Mercury Cougar Wiring Diagram is essentially a schematic or blueprint that illustrates the electrical pathways within your vehicle. It shows how all the various components – from the headlights and radio to the engine control module and anti-lock brakes – are connected by wires. These diagrams are crucial for understanding the flow of electrical current and identifying potential issues. The ability to read and interpret a wiring diagram is incredibly important for accurate troubleshooting and repair. Without it, trying to fix an electrical problem would be like navigating a maze blindfolded.
These diagrams break down the complex electrical system into manageable parts. You'll typically find information on:
- Wire colors and gauges
- Component locations and their corresponding terminals
- Fuse and relay assignments
- Ground points
They are invaluable for a variety of tasks, including:
- Diagnosing electrical faults (e.g., a malfunctioning taillight, a dead battery, or an unresponsive dashboard light)
- Installing aftermarket accessories (like a new stereo or alarm system)
- Performing routine maintenance that involves electrical components
For instance, a basic troubleshooting scenario might involve a non-functional horn. A wiring diagram would allow you to trace the circuit from the horn button, through the relay and fuse, to the horn itself. You could then test each component in sequence, guided by the diagram, to pinpoint the exact point of failure. Here's a simplified look at what a diagram might show for a basic circuit:
